* Specifications *

Manufacturer: Chance-Vought Aircraft, Inc.

Type: Carrier-based fighter

Crew: 1 Pilot

Powerplant: Pratt & Whitney J-57-P-4A with afterburner

Wingspan: 35' 8"

Wing Area: 375 sq ft

Length: 54' 3"

Height: 15 ft 9 in

Tread: 9 ft 8 in

Weight: Empty 16,483 lbs
Basic 17,673 lbs
Design 23,192 lbs
Maximum Combat 24,475 lbs
Maximum Takeoff 27,938 lbs (catapult)
Maximum Landing 22,000 lbs (arrested)

Speed: Mach 1.5+

Range: 600 miles tactical
1,195-1,295 nautical miles Combat Range

Armament: Four 20-mm aircraft guns front fuselage and 500 rounds.
Thirty-two 2.75-inch rockets carried internally or in rocket pack, centerline fuselage or
two AIM-9 missiles externally on pylon each side of fuselage.


XF8U-1: Experimental version of the F8U-1.

F8U-1 (F-8A): Single place, swept-wing, carrier-based day fighter. Equipped to carry AIM-9 Sidewinder
missiles.

F8U-1E (F-8B): F-8A equipped with AN/APS-67 visual assist radar.

F8U-1P (RF-8A): Photographic version of F-8A

F8U-1T (TF-8A): Two-seat trainer

XF8U-2: Experimental version of the F8U-2

F8U-2 (F-8C): Improved version of F-8B with improved engine and fixed ventral fins.

F8U-2N (F-8D): Similar to F-8C. Limited all-weather aircraft with AN/APQ-83 radar, autopilot, higher thrust
engine and additional fuel capacity. Equipped to carry four Sidewinder missiles.

F8U-2NE (F-8E): Similar to F-8D except equipped with AN/APQ-94 radar with larger antenna.

F8U-3: Improved version of F8U with all-weather capabilities.

F8U-1D (DF-8A): Configured as a high-speed control aircraft for Regulus I/II missile.

F8U-1KD (QF-8A): Configured as a Regulus I missile high-speed trounce and control aircraft.

DF-8F: Configured for remote control of QF-9F and QF-9G aircraft and BQM-34A, AQM-34B and AQM-34C
drones.

RF-8G: F-8A modernized for increased service life and reconnaissance capabilities.

F-8H: F-8D modified to include external wing store capability, increased strength fuselage, lead-launch computer and other improvements.

F-8J: F-8E with increased fuselage and wings, and other improvements.

F-8K: Similar to F-8C but with structural changes to fuselage, wing and landing gear.

F-8L: Similar to F-8B but with structural changes to fuselage, wing and landing gear.

F-8M: Similar to F-8A but with structural changes to fuselage, wing and landing gear.
